wx.lib.sheet列和行名称

时间:2013-04-27 18:37:55

标签: python wxpython

是否有可能以某种方式更改wx.lib.sheet小部件中的列名和行名? 例如,从A,B,C,D到姓名,姓氏,年龄,DOB。

如果没有相似的方法来制作Sheetlike数据输入GUI?

1 个答案:

答案 0 :(得分:1)

至于wx.lib.sheet.CSheet类扩展wx.grid.Grid,有SetColLabelValue方法:

column_names = ['Name', 'Surname', 'Age', 'DOB']
sheet = CSheet(panel)
for index, name in enumerate(column_names):
    sheet.SetColLabelValue(index, name)
sizer.Add(sheet)

SetRowLabelValue用于行。